当前位置: 首页 > 网络安全

CDN防御的原理是什么?CDN防御的适用场景

  CDN防御服务器通过分布式架构、流量清洗、智能路由等技术,为网站提供加速访问与安全防护,适用于电商、金融、游戏等易受攻击的业务场景,能有效抵御DDoS、CC攻击并隐藏源站IP,但需结合业务需求选择服务商并配置防护策略,跟着小编一起详细了解下。

  一、CDN防御的原理是什么

  1.分布式架构

  CDN在全球各地部署大量边缘节点,用户请求被智能路由到最近的节点,而非直接访问源站。这种架构不仅加速内容分发,还能分散攻击流量,避免单点过载。

  2.流量清洗与过滤

  异常流量识别:通过数据包规则过滤、数据流指纹检测等技术,实时监测并拦截恶意流量。

  自动化防护:部分CDN支持AI动态防护,基于机器学习分析请求特征,识别新型攻击模式。

  规则拦截:基于预定义规则阻断SQL注入、XSS等Web攻击。

  3.隐藏源站IP

  域名解析修改:将网站域名解析到CDN生成的CNAME记录,隐藏真实服务器IP,使攻击者无法直接定位源站。

  私有网络回源:通过专线或VPN连接CDN与源站,避免数据在公网传输,降低泄露风险。

  4.缓存加速与负载均衡

  内容缓存:边缘节点缓存静态资源,减少回源请求,降低服务器负载。

  负载均衡:动态调整流量分配,确保高并发场景下网站稳定运行。

  二、CDN防御的适用场景

  1.电商行业

  大促防护:CDN可抵御瞬时流量激增和黑客攻击,保障交易系统稳定。

  防盗链与API保护:限制敏感接口的访问频率,防止恶意爬虫抓取商品数据。

  2.金融支付系统

  多层次防护:集成WAF和SSL加密,防御DDoS攻击的同时保障数据传输安全。

  合规性要求:满足PCI DSS等标准,保护用户资金交易信息。

  3.游戏服务器

  低延迟访问:通过边缘节点就近分发游戏资源,减少玩家延迟。

  弹性带宽:应对游戏开服、活动期间的流量峰值,过滤四层攻击。

  4.政府与企业官网

  内容防篡改:实时扫描网站漏洞,防止恶意代码注入或页面篡改。

  SEO优化:加速内容分发提升用户体验,间接提高搜索引擎排名。

CDN防御的原理是什么.jpg

  三、CDN防御的关键功能

  1.安全策略配置

  IP黑白名单:阻止已知恶意IP访问,允许白名单IP优先通过。

  地理封锁:限制特定国家或地区的访问,降低跨境攻击风险。

  速率限制:对单IP的请求频率设置阈值,防止高频请求耗尽资源。

  2.数据传输加密

  HTTPS强制跳转:自动将HTTP请求重定向到HTTPS,防止中间人攻击。

  HSTS头部:通过Strict-Transport-Security头强制浏览器使用HTTPS。

  证书自动更新:支持Let's Encrypt等免费证书,避免过期导致安全漏洞。

  3.监控与日志分析

  实时告警:配置异常流量告警,及时响应攻击。

  日志归档:存储访问日志用于事后分析,结合ELK堆栈进行可视化分析。

  4.高级防护功能

  机器人识别:通过JA3指纹、行为分析识别爬虫工具。

  验证码挑战:对可疑流量弹出验证码,区分人类与机器请求。

  动态内容保护:对含敏感信息的页面(如用户中心)禁用缓存,确保实时回源。

  四、CDN防御的选型建议

  1.服务商资质

  选择具备等保三级认证、ISO 27001信息安全管理体系的服务商,确保服务合规性。

  优先选择支持GDPR等国际标准的服务商,满足跨境业务需求。

  2.防御能力

  抗DDoS能力:确认服务商能否抵御TB级攻击流量,支持Anycast网络分散攻击。

  WAF功能:检查是否支持SQL注入、XSS等Web攻击防护,以及自定义规则配置。

  3.网络性能

  节点分布:选择全球节点覆盖广、尤其是目标用户所在地区节点密集的服务商。

  带宽质量:测试服务商的带宽稳定性,避免高峰期出现拥塞。

  4.成本与扩展性

  套餐选择:根据业务规模选择合适的服务套餐,避免过度采购或资源不足。

  弹性扩展:确认服务商是否支持按需扩展带宽和防御能力,应对突发流量。

  五、CDN防御的局限性及应对

  1.动态交互业务防护不足

  CDN主要优化静态内容分发,对动态交互业务的防护需配合高防服务器或WAF实现深层防护。

  2.超大流量攻击场景

  面对超过CDN节点承载能力的攻击,需叠加高防IP或本地清洗设备,形成多层次防御体系。

  3.配置复杂度

  CDN防御需结合业务特性配置防护策略,建议定期演练应急方案,确保防护体系与业务需求动态匹配。

  CDN防御的核心原理是通过分布式边缘节点构建多层级防护体系。用户请求首先被智能路由至最近的CDN节点,而非直接访问源站,从而分散攻击流量并隐藏真实IP。边缘节点内置流量清洗模块,可实时识别并拦截DDoS、CC等恶意请求,同时通过缓存静态资源减少回源压力,兼顾加速与安全。


猜你喜欢